More Record Cold In Wyoming

Last year February 22 was the coldest on record here in Cheyenne, Wyoming by a wide margin, with a maximum temperature of -2F (-19C)  This year will likely be second or third coldest. The forecast minimum temperature of -14F (-24C) … Continue reading
